What is Venus Sidereal period?

Venus has a sidereal period (orbital period relative to distant stars) of approximately 224.7 Earth days. This means it takes Venus about 224.7 days to complete one orbit around the Sun.

What are two reasons the period of Venus is shorter than the period of Earth?

Which period - revolutionary period or rotational period? Obviously it's the time taken to orbit the Sun that's meant because the time Venus takes to rotate is much LONGER than Earth. Two reasons are: 1) Venus has a shorter orbital distance to travel. 2) Venus orbits at a higher speed.
